Let's start by understanding what sand mineral fiber ceiling boards are. These boards are made from a combination of sand and mineral fibers. The sand provides strength and durability, while the mineral fibers contribute to various properties, including heat insulation.


Now, let's dig into the heat insulation performance. Heat insulation is all about reducing the transfer of heat between different areas. In the case of ceiling boards, it means keeping the heat from escaping in the winter and preventing it from entering in the summer.
One of the key factors that determine the heat insulation performance of sand mineral fiber ceiling boards is their density. Generally, a higher - density board tends to have better heat insulation properties. The dense structure of the board acts as a barrier to heat transfer. When the board is installed on the ceiling, it slows down the movement of heat through the ceiling, which can significantly impact the energy efficiency of a building.
Another important aspect is the composition of the mineral fibers. The unique structure of these fibers creates small air pockets within the board. Air is a poor conductor of heat, so these air pockets act as insulators. They trap the heat and prevent it from passing through the board easily. For example, if you have a room with a sand mineral fiber ceiling board installed, the heat generated by a heater in the room will be less likely to escape through the ceiling, keeping the room warmer for longer periods.
In addition to the density and fiber composition, the thickness of the sand mineral fiber ceiling board also plays a role. Thicker boards usually offer better heat insulation. A thicker layer provides more material for the heat to pass through, and with the combined effect of the dense structure and air pockets, it can effectively reduce heat transfer.
Let's talk about some real - world applications. In residential buildings, sand mineral fiber ceiling boards can be a great choice for bedrooms, living rooms, and kitchens. By improving the heat insulation, they can help reduce heating and cooling costs. For instance, during the cold winter months, less heat will be lost through the ceiling, so you won't have to run your heater as often or at a high temperature. In the summer, the boards can prevent the hot outdoor air from seeping into the rooms, reducing the need for excessive air - conditioning.
In commercial buildings such as offices, shops, and restaurants, the heat insulation performance of sand mineral fiber ceiling boards can also have a significant impact. These buildings often have large areas to heat and cool, and any improvement in heat insulation can lead to substantial energy savings. Moreover, a well - insulated ceiling can create a more comfortable environment for employees and customers.
